СПОСОБ ФОРМИРОВАНИЯ АКУСТИЧЕСКОГО ОБРАЗА

Номер: RU2119785C1

Способ предназначен для преобразования зрительной информации в другие виды ее восприятия для обучения или общения со слепыми. Графический образ формируют во фронтальной плоскости с помощью четырех направленных попарно сопряженных акустических преобразователей, на которые подают широкополосный сигнал. Основная гармоника fo его лежит в диапазоне частот 200 - 500 Гц. Амплитудой и частотой звукового сигнала управляют как линейной функцией удаления курсора от центра плоскости графического образа. Одновременно осуществляют девиацию Δf частоты fo по вертикали в зависимости от удаления курсора от горизонтальной оси фронтальной плоскости. Акустический образ воспроизводят в реальном масштабе времени посредством программного обеспечения. Способ позволяет сформировать изоморфные визуальным акустические образы с реальной пространственной локализацией за счет формирования условий, повышающих точность локализации границ движущегося звукового курсора во фронтальной плоскости. 4 з.п.ф-лы, 4 ил.

СПОСОБ ВЫПОЛНЕНИЯ СЕЛЕКТИВНОЙ ЛАЗЕРНОЙ ТРАБЕКУЛОПЛАСТИКИ У ПАЦИЕНТОВ С ОТКРЫТОУГОЛЬНОЙ ГЛАУКОМОЙ

Номер: RU2489124C1

Изобретение относится к медицине, а именно к офтальмологии, и предназначено для лечения пациентов с открытоугольной глаукомой. Воздействуют лазерным излучением Nd-YAG лазера с удвоением частоты с длиной волны 532 нм на структуру трабекулярной сети. Диаметр пятна 400 мкм. Мощность лазерного излучения точно адаптируется к пигментации трабекулы путем изменения энергии на 10% до уровня, необходимого и достаточного для селективной деструкции пигментированных клеток в каждой точке воздействия. Показателем достаточности воздействия является образование мелких кавитационных пузырьков в водянистой влаге вне трабекулярной сети без видимых следов повреждения трабекулы. Если подобранная мощность в месте воздействия ниже оптимальной, увеличивают мощность, а следующее пятно наносится с частичным перекрытием предыдущего. Обрабатывают всю область трабекулы. Способ позволяет оптимизировать параметры лазерного воздействия, сведя при этом к минимуму побочные эффекты. 3 пр.

СПОСОБ АКУСТИЧЕСКОГО ПРЕДСТАВЛЕНИЯ ПРОСТРАНСТВЕННОЙ ИНФОРМАЦИИ ДЛЯ ИНВАЛИДОВ ПО ЗРЕНИЮ

Номер: RU93011227A
Принадлежит:

Способ акустического представления пространственной информации для инвалидов по зрению относится к созданию приборов для ориентирования в окружающем пространстве. Известные технические системы, как правило, представляют собой ультразвуковые локаторы, работающие в диапазоне 40 - 120 кГц. Для восприятия слуховым анализатором человека отраженный сигнал необходимо перевести в область звуковых частот, что осуществляют с помощью выделения низкочастотной огибающей. При этом воспринимаемый слуховым анализатором сигнал содержит информацию главным образом с дистанции до объекта. В предлагаемом способе с целью согласования частотного и временного диапазонов акустического сигнала со слуховым анализатором используется изменение временного масштаба отраженного сигнала в каждом канале приема. Излучается ультракороткий зондирующий импульс. В этом случае эхо-сигнал близок к импульсной характеристике объекта. Восприятие инвалидом по зрению сигналов, отраженных от нескольких ближайших объектов, позволяет ...
